[MGNLUI-7842] Upload&Edit dialog is in background when access within ck-editor Created: 08/Feb/23  Updated: 28/Mar/23  Resolved: 23/Mar/23

Status: Closed
Project: Magnolia UI
Component/s: None
Affects Version/s: 6.2.28
Fix Version/s: 6.3.0, 6.2.30

Type: Bug Priority: Neutral
Reporter: Sergio Marino Assignee: Sang Ngo Huu
Resolution: Fixed Votes: 0
Labels: None
Σ Remaining Estimate: Not Specified Remaining Estimate: Not Specified
Σ Time Spent: 6.25d Time Spent: Not Specified
Σ Original Estimate: Not Specified Original Estimate: Not Specified

Attachments: PNG File 6_3.png     Text File custom-config.txt     PNG File demo_screenshot.png     PNG File screenshot_1.png     PNG File screenshot_2.png     PNG File screenshot_3.png     PNG File screenshot_4.png    
Issue Links:
Cloners
is cloned by MGNLDAM-1141 CLONE - Upload&Edit dialog is in back... Closed
causality
Sub-Tasks:
Key
Summary
Type
Status
Assignee
MGNLUI-7926 Implement Sub-task Completed Sang Ngo Huu  
MGNLUI-7927 Review PR Sub-task Completed Quach Hao Thien  
MGNLUI-7928 Pre-int QA + PM Sub-task Closed Quach Hao Thien  
MGNLUI-7929 QA Sub-task Completed Daniel Alonso  
MGNLUI-7950 Add doc Sub-task Completed Sang Ngo Huu  
MGNLUI-7965 Docu rv Documentation Task Completed Adrian Brooks  
Template:
Acceptance criteria:
Empty
Task DoD:
[X]* Doc/release notes changes? Comment present?
[X]* Downstream builds green?
[X]* Solution information and context easily available?
[X]* Tests
[X]* FixVersion filled and not yet released
[ ]  Architecture Decision Record (ADR)
Bug DoR:
[X]* Steps to reproduce, expected, and actual results filled
[X]* Affected version filled
Release notes required:
Yes
Documentation update required:
Yes
Date of First Response:
Epic Link: Dialogs
Sprint: Nucleus 32
Story Points: 3
Team: Nucleus
Work Started:

 Description   

Steps to reproduce

(you can use the custom-config.txt file as the configuration pointed to configJsFile property in order to create the use-case)

  1. use a component with CKEditor and use the image Button/plugin to choose or even edit a selected image into the editor (screenshot_1.png)
    (you can just open a dialog like the following):
    form:
      properties:
        richText:
          label: Text editor
          class: info.magnolia.dam.app.field.DamRichTextFieldDefinition
          configJsFile: /.resources/ckeditor/custom-config.js                           #this config is the one attached in the ticket at custom-config.txt
    
  2. Click on the Browse server button to upen the image choose dialog (screenshot_2)
  3. Click on the Upload&Edit button to upload a new asset (screenshot_3)
  4. The upload&edit dialog window is placed behind the CKE window and can not be access. (screenshot_4)

.. Logs, screenshots, gifs...

Expected results

The upload&edit dialog window is placed in front of the CKE window and can be access.

.. Justify non-trivial expectations with a link to a doc or a relevant discussion.

Actual results

The upload&edit dialog window is placed behind the CKE window and can not be access.

Workaround

Development notes


Generated at Mon Feb 12 09:49:49 CET 2024 using Jira 9.4.2#940002-sha1:46d1a51de284217efdcb32434eab47a99af2938b.